LINUX.ORG.RU

Вышел Debian 13

 


2

6

Чуть более, чем через 2 года после выхода Debian 12, вышел новый релиз одного из самых долгоживущих на текущий момент (более 30 лет!) дистрибутивов, который получил кодовое имя «trixie». Этот стабильный релиз, как и предыдущий, будет поддерживаться в течение 5 последующих лет.

К сожалению, в этом релизе мы потеряли поддержку множества архитектур, главным образом, 32-битных, в том числе остающейся второй по популярности среди пользователей Debian архитектуры i386. Тем не менее, появилась поддержка одной новой архитектуры — riscv64. Впервые c 2000 года поддерживается всего 6 архитектур:

  • amd64
  • aarch64 (ARM64)
  • ARMv7
  • ppc64el
  • riscv64
  • s390x

Также есть ограниченная поддержка архитектуры armel, но без debian-installer и только для одноплатников Raspberry Pi 1, Zero и Zero W.

В выпуск Debian 12 добавлено 14 100 новых пакетов, а общее число пакетов достигло 69 830. По тем или иным причинам 8 840 пакетов были удалены. 44 326 пакетов обновлены в этом выпуске. Общий объем пакетов в Debian «bookworm» составляет 403 гигабайт и содержит 1 463 291 186 строк исходного кода.

Версии основных пакетов в Debian 13:

  • Apache: 2.4.64
  • Bash: 5.2.37
  • BIND: 9.20
  • Cryptsetup 2.7
  • Curl/libcurl: 8.14.1
  • Emacs: 30.1
  • Exim: 4.98
  • GCC: 14.2
  • GIMP: 3.0.4
  • GnuPG: 2.4.7
  • Inkscape: 1.4
  • Glibc: 2.41
  • LLVM/Clang: 19 (по умолчанию), 17 и 18 доступны в репозитоиях
  • MariaDB: 11.8
  • Nginx: 1.26
  • OpenJDK: 21
  • OpenLDAP: 2.6.10
  • OpenSSH: 10.0p1
  • OpenSSL: 3.5
  • Perl: 5.40
  • PHP: 8.4
  • Postfix: 3.10
  • PostgreSQL: 17
  • Python 3: 3.13
  • Rustc: 1.85
  • Samba: 4.22
  • Systemd: 257
  • Vim: 9.1

Ядро Linux обновлено до версии 6.12.

Версии окружений рабочего стола в Debian 13:

  • GNOME 48
  • KDE Plasma 6.3
  • Xfce 4.20
  • MATE 1.26
  • LXQt 2.1.0
  • LXDE 13 (0.99.3)

Для поддерживаемых архитектур официально есть возможность обновиться с предыдущего стабильного выпуска Debian 12 до Debian 13.

Release notes на английском языке

Release notes частично на русском языке

>>> Новость о релизе на сайте Debian

★★★★

Проверено: cetjs2 ()
Последнее исправление: cetjs2 (всего исправлений: 8)
Ответ на: комментарий от mister_VA

Если у вас риббон отжирает пол-экрана, у вас всё равно не получится комфортно работать с текстом длиннее нескольких строк. Со смартфона сидите?

По сравнию с риббоном у vi и emacs наглядный интуитивно понятный интерфейс управления.

А, троллите. Я что-то не распознал сначала.

slepoy_pew
()
Ответ на: комментарий от DrRulez

В смысле приспичило. Как минимум конфиденциальность, и обеспечение работы КИ если тот же инет пропадет.

mx__ ★★★★★
()

Впервые c 2000 года поддерживается всего 6 архитектур

Печально. Особенно что классический x86 выкинули.

watchcat382
()
Ответ на: комментарий от watchcat382

Выкинули то, что людям нужно, а экзотику фанатично поддерживают. С пакетами у них такая же фигня: куча безнадежно устаревших модулей для скриптовых языков и прочего шлака, а virtualbox в прошлый релиз не попал.

bread
()
Ответ на: комментарий от slepoy_pew

Если у вас риббон отжирает пол-экрана, у вас всё равно не получится комфортно работать с текстом длиннее нескольких строк.

С классическим меню прекрасно работается везде, а смысл риббона от меня ускрользнул. На монитрах 16:10 или ещё хуже на 2,39:1 он действительно сжирает рабочее пространство.

Риббон – это то самое классическое бессмысленное изменение под видом инноваций. Простой вопрос: нахрена риббоновские кнопки в 6 раз больше классических иконок?

mister_VA ★★
()

Раньше я предвзято относился к Debian из-за его плохой подготовленности для Linux-десктопов и заскорузлости пакетов, но потом я повзрослел и понял что Debian это тот самый краеугольный и фундаментальный камень, на котором зиждется куча популярных десктопных дистрибутивов которые все знают и огромное количество серверных решений.

А ещё это неплохой конструктор для сборки дистров под всякую экзотику, типа M68K, недавно понадобилось и внезапно кроме Debian’а и нет больше никаких вариантов.

В общем, Long Live, Debian! Надеюсь, что дистрибутив не коснутся проблемы раздутости инфраструктуры на поддержание всего этого многообразия пакетов и архитектур, а устаревшие и неудобные workflow будут меняться на более удобные.

ARMv7

Интересно когда депрекейтнут. Походу единственная 32-битная архитектура осталась.

EXL ★★★★★
()

поставил с dvd, но в sources.list только этот dvd, да еще и закоментирован, и зачем так криво сделано ?

x905 ★★★★★
()
Ответ на: комментарий от x905

поставил с dvd, но в sources.list только этот dvd, да еще и закоментирован, и зачем так криво сделано ?

Во время установки вас спросили, использовать ли зеркало из сети. Вы ответили отрицательно, поэтому никаких сетевых источников и не добавилось.

Если хотите добавить их теперь самостоятельно, то см. пример в /usr/share/doc/apt/examples/debian.sources.

Rootlexx ★★★★★
()
Ответ на: комментарий от Rootlexx

Во время установки вас спросили, использовать ли зеркало из сети

да, припоминаю, но я полагал это только на этап установки т.к. ставил с «usb-dvd» и полагал что с него быстрее будет, но учту на будущее

ну и нет никакого смысла оставлять dvd диск в sources.list, да еще закоментированным, очевидно в процессе жизни ОС обновлению нужны будут

x905 ★★★★★
()
Ответ на: комментарий от Polugnom

хм, учту, но и добавив в sources.list три строки репов, удалось ставить пакеты из интернета

x905 ★★★★★
()
Ответ на: комментарий от pekmop1024

Ты чего так разорался, будто у тебя рука Наделлы застряла в интересном месте?

Ты сделал мой вечер этим комментарием! :)

Благодарю!

SomeV
()
Ответ на: комментарий от mister_VA

Что такое «бесшовная интеграция» субд и почтового клиента? Это когда одной кнопкой можно слить конкуренту коммерческую тайну из бд по е-мейлу?

Спасибо! Реально остроумный комментарий :)

SomeV
()
Ответ на: комментарий от bread

Если люди не шлют патчи и не закрывают баги того, что нужно, значит это не совсем нужное. Желающих поддерживать тот же Virtualbox хотя бы в течение 3 лет не нашлось.

undef ★★★
()
Ответ на: комментарий от Rootlexx

systemd просто сообщает вам, что сервис отказывается завершаться адекватно, и вместо того чтобы ругать systemd

Ошибкой было бы думать (с)
Пусть завершает неадекватно, раз команда была.

BydymTydym ★★
()
Ответ на: комментарий от MoldAndLimeHoney

А содомiты прям важная часть проекта Debian?

Фу ты, блин! Нет, пора на фряху переобуваться. То Линус мурло своё истинное покажет, то радужные толпой на свет лезут…

BydymTydym ★★
()
Ответ на: комментарий от BydymTydym

Пусть завершает неадекватно, раз команда была.

Он и завершает, после истечения установленного в конфигурации времени ожидания.

Rootlexx ★★★★★
()
Ответ на: комментарий от bread

Лорчую. Там огромный раздел «science», пакеты из которого используют полтора мэнээса, но фишка в том, что мейнтейнерами их являются либо авторы, либо пользователи. А у тех же популярных мультимедиа-приложений пользователей может, и много, но они не профессионалы, чтобы их поддерживать, а авторы либо давно забили, либо не горят желанием воплощать хотелки дебьянщиков о переходе на новые версии QT или питона — у них-то всё работает.

alegz ★★★★★
()
Ответ на: комментарий от nicholas_ru

Без ядра, к сожалению. Я-то себе собрал, но так и генту можно собрать.

squareroot ★★★★
() автор топика
Ответ на: комментарий от hobbit

Там проблема в том, что systemd не имеет никакой возможности принудительно выполнить перезагрузку.

Вот завис у тебя сервис, и что? Ждать полторы минуты?

На ctrl+alt+del systemd отказывается реагировать в этом случае.

То есть машина становится неуправляемой.

Вот в чем проблема, а не в тайминге. Железная коробка должна слушаться пользователя во всех случаях, когда в ней есть ОС, и она не зависла. А тут фактически система зависла.

wandrien ★★★
()
Ответ на: комментарий от hobbit

И еще у меня был случай на днях, машина не перезагрузилась, потому что не смогла размонтировать своп. Дошла до последних шагов остановки и зависла.

Представь себе ситуацию на сервере, ты перезагружаешь машину по ssh, а обратно машина на связь не выходит. Лезешь в удаленный доступ к физическому терминалу у хостера, а там сюрприз.

Но тут я не знаю, кто больше виноват: systemd или ядро.

Первый раз столкнулся с таким багом.

wandrien ★★★
()
Ответ на: комментарий от bread

Устаревшие на полгода версии в свежайшем релизе.

Используй флатпак для десктопного софта.

Docker для серверного.

wandrien ★★★
()
Ответ на: комментарий от wandrien

А дебиан тогда зачем? Сто тысяч пакетов, мудрые седовласые ментейнеры, штабильность, вот это всё?

bread
()
Ответ на: комментарий от hobbit

Хороший аргумент. Rootlexx?

Я ХЗ, зачем надо было меня кастить, ну да ладно.

Тут палка о двух концах. С одной стороны, если ты абсолютно уверен, что принудительное завершение работы сервиса никаких негативных последствий иметь не будет, и что ожидание лишь приведёт к тому же самому исходу, только позже, то тут соглашусь, что возможность такого досрочного принудительного завершения была бы полезна.

С другой стороны, позиция «пользователь всегда лучше знает» — это просто смешно. У нас тут в последнее время транзакции «пропадают», потому что сервис руками грохают по аналогу SIGKILL, так что даже если конкретный wandrien всегда может точно сказать, безопасно ли досрочно принудительно завершать сервис, то в общем случае пользователь знает примерно нихрена.

Так что тут, наверное, лучшим выходом стала бы поддержка такого принудительного завершения, но отключённая по умолчанию. Кому надо — включит сам, но и ответственность тогда будет на нём.

Rootlexx ★★★★★
()
Ответ на: комментарий от Rootlexx

так что даже если конкретный wandrien всегда может точно сказать, безопасно ли

Данный конкретный wandrien всегда точно знает, что от машины требуется лично ему как админу, потому что машина это просто механизм.

Например, требуется перезагрузка СРОЧНО ПРЯМО СЕЙЧАС.

Это не задача железки - принимать решения верхнего уровня. Это всегда задача человека, который за своё решение несёт какую-то ответственность и обладает более полным контекстом задачи.

Точно такой же условный wandrien может поставить таймаут на 10 секунд, что даже корректно завершающие работу сервисы могут не успевать завершиться.

У нас тут в последнее время транзакции «пропадают», потому что сервис руками грохают по аналогу SIGKILL

Ну и как видишь, никакой systemd не помешает, если админ - дебил. А прятать SIGKILL от админа - это как снимать огнетушители с положенных для них мест, потому что вдруг кто-то, кто к ним имеет доступ, дурак, и огнетушителем кому-то по башке даст.

wandrien ★★★
()
Ответ на: комментарий от wandrien

При моём в целом положительном отношении к systemd, этот момент тоже раздражает.

Friearch
()
Ответ на: комментарий от alegz

Ядро то тут каким боком? Оно о процессе перезагрузки не в курсе, это как раз задача инит-системы.

Возможно, что было зависание какого-либо важного потока именно в ядре. Я не разбирался, так как проблема пока была разовая. Если повторится, будем смотреть.

wandrien ★★★
()
Ответ на: комментарий от bread

свежий firefox не соберешь

А можно пожалуйста какую-нибудь реальную ссылку,пройдя по которой я бы увидел что мне критически необходимо вот прямо срочно обновить браузер? А то что-то на Vivaldi 3.8.2259.42 давно сижу и не жалуюсь.

watchcat382
()
Ответ на: комментарий от almukantarat
  1. а что тебе такое нужно, чего нет в основном репозитории?

  2. по приведенной тобой ссылке последнее сообщение о том, что репозиторий обновлен для trixie.

TeopeTuK ★★★★★
()
Ответ на: комментарий от TeopeTuK

Привычка. Всегда его добавлял. А сейчас пускает только через VPN (актуально на сейчас, МТС, раздача с телефона).

almukantarat
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.